About this apartment rental

Three newly revamped apartments in a pretty, salmon-pink, antique palazzetto within the calm and cultured setting of upmarket San Samuele.



Elegantly attired in a classic, homely style and peacefully positioned within a genteel neighbourhood dotted with galleries and antique shops well clear of the hustle and bustle yet close to Campo Santo Stefano, these inviting apartments are of differing sizes and sleep up to 10 guests when taken together.



Just a few steps from the renowned Palazzo Grassi Museum of Modern Art in a parish that legendary lover Casanova called home, the palazzetto offers a stylish address to rest easy within a short and pleasant stroll of the many attractions of St. Mark’s Square.



Moments from the illustrious Palazzo Mocenigo on the Grand Canal (the one time Venetian bolthole of ‘mad, bad and dangerous to know’ British romantic poet and literary figure, Lord Byron) and boasting air-conditioning, Wi-Fi and a warm and welcoming ambience in each, the Ca’ Grassi apartments comprise:



Ca’ Grassi 3 (Sleeps 3 on the 3rd (top) Floor reached by stairs – no lift)



Communal palazzetto entrance with stairs rising up to the apartment entrance



•The apartment’s internal hallway and short stairway leading directly up to the stylish, high-vaulted, loft-style main sitting/dining room/kitchenette – a characterful space dressed in sun-bleached eau de nil and parched papyrus colours featuring a large L-shaped sofa, bespoke shelving and cabinetry inset with wall-mounted TV plus several windows overlooking the ‘Salizada’

•A dining area seating 4 to the centre of the room, plus a simple and well-equipped kitchenette to the rear



•A darling ‘altana’ roof terrace just off the main room – southwest-facing, furnished and an ideal spot for taking breakfast, or unwinding in the sunshine after a busy - or not so busy! - time around town



•A charming double bedroom to the rear, featuring a low and heavily beamed ceiling and a double bed (positioned fairly low to the floor due to the ceiling height)



•A refreshed bathroom with bathtub and shower over, set between the main room and bedroom





* Are you part of a larger group who’d like to stay close to each other but in separate apartments? We offer 2 other apartments in this Venetian palazzetto (little palace): Ca’ Grassi 1 (on the 2nd Floor) and Ca’ Grassi 2 (also on the 2nd Floor)





OUR COMMENT



A property to delight in all its wood and linen loveliness...! Much loved by previous guests and now refurbished to offer comfortable and peaceful accommodation in a great spot… and with an ‘altana’ rooftop terrace too!



Situated right beside ‘Casa Veronese’ (once the home of the 16th Century Italian Renaissance painter, Paolo Veronese) and within steps of the neighbourhood grocery store/delicatessen, a wine shop, a range of cafes/osterie (including those fringing the nearby Campo Santo Stefano), plus the gallery of interior designer Chiarastella Cattana - a discreetly sophisticated showroom of fine and distinctively woven textiles and furnishings – and, for scent-lovers, the Venice outlet of the famous Florentine ‘Officina Profumo Farmaceutica di Santa Maria Novella’ (one of the oldest pharmacies in the world and one time fragrance maker to Catherine de’ Medici).



A stone’s throw to the Accademia Bridge crossing the Grand Canal over to Dorsoduro and conveniently close the vaporetto (water bus) stops at San Samuele and Sant' Angelo for easy travel around the city, and to the ‘traghetto’ gondola ferry which, during operating times, carries passengers across the Grand Canal between Calle Del Tragheto (near Sant’ Angelo) and San Toma in the district of San Polo
